哈希竞猜游戏玩法有哪些?全面解析哈希竞猜游戏玩法有哪些

哈希竞猜游戏玩法有哪些?全面解析哈希竞猜游戏玩法有哪些,

好,用户让我写一篇关于“哈希竞猜游戏玩法有哪些”的文章,还给了一个示例标题和结构,我需要理解用户的需求,他们可能是在寻找关于哈希竞猜游戏的详细玩法介绍,可能是为了写博客、做游戏攻略,或者用于教育用途。

我要分析用户提供的示例内容,标题是“哈希竞猜游戏玩法有哪些?全面解析”,文章结构分为引言、几种玩法、注意事项、总结和结论,看起来用户希望文章结构清晰,内容详尽,覆盖各种可能的玩法。

我需要考虑用户可能没有明确提到的需求,他们可能希望文章不仅列出玩法,还要解释每种玩法的规则、策略和应用,这样读者才能全面理解并应用这些知识,用户可能希望文章有吸引力,能够引起读者的兴趣,所以可能需要加入一些生动的例子或应用场景。

在写引言时,我应该强调哈希竞猜游戏的流行性和挑战性,让读者感受到游戏的魅力,每种玩法的介绍需要详细说明规则、策略和可能的变体,这样读者可以有更深入的理解,在密码破解玩法中,可以详细解释哈希函数的工作原理,以及常见的攻击方法,如暴力破解、字典攻击等。

注意事项部分需要提醒读者在实际操作中可能遇到的问题,比如时间限制、资源消耗,以及安全性和道德问题,这些内容可以帮助读者避免在实际应用中犯错,同时提升他们的安全意识。

总结部分要简明扼要,强调哈希竞猜游戏的挑战性和学习价值,鼓励读者去尝试和探索,结论部分则可以展望未来,提到哈希技术的发展和更多创新玩法的可能性。

我要确保文章的字数不少于2886个字,这意味着每个部分都需要详细展开,避免过于简略,语言要保持专业但易懂,适合不同层次的读者阅读。

我需要按照用户提供的结构,深入分析每种玩法,提供实用的策略和注意事项,确保文章内容丰富、结构清晰,满足用户的需求。

哈希函数在现代密码学中扮演着至关重要的角色,它不仅用于数据完整性验证,还被广泛应用于各种安全协议和游戏设计中,哈希竞猜作为一种基于哈希函数的智力游戏,近年来逐渐受到关注,这种游戏不仅考验参与者的数学思维能力,还要求他们具备一定的密码学知识储备,本文将详细介绍哈希竞猜游戏的几种玩法,并探讨其背后的原理和应用。

哈希竞猜游戏的基本概念

哈希函数是一种将任意长度的输入数据映射到固定长度字符串的函数,其核心特性包括确定性、高效计算和抗冲突性,在哈希竞猜游戏中,玩家通常需要通过已知的哈希值和部分明文字来猜测完整的明文。

游戏的基本流程如下:

  1. 游戏方生成一个随机的明文,并计算其哈希值。
  2. 游戏参与者通过询问特定的明文字来逐步推断出完整的明文。
  3. 在规定时间内,参与者需要尽可能多地猜出正确的明文。

这种游戏的设计不仅考验参与者的逻辑推理能力,还要求他们熟悉哈希函数的特性。

常见的哈希竞猜游戏玩法

密码破解挑战

玩家需要根据已知的哈希值和部分明文字,猜测出完整的密码,这种玩法类似于字典攻击,但通常不会涉及真实的密码安全问题。

  • 游戏规则:

    • 游戏方生成一个随机的密码(如8位数字)。
    • 玩家通过询问特定的数字来逐步推断出完整的密码。
    • 每次询问后,游戏方会返回哈希值的差异信息(如相同位置的字符是否匹配)。
  • 玩法策略:

    • 通过系统性地猜测每个位置的字符,逐步缩小可能的范围。
    • 利用哈希函数的抗冲突性,避免无效猜测。

哈希碰撞寻找

哈希碰撞是指两个不同的输入数据生成相同的哈希值,在哈希竞猜游戏中,玩家可以通过寻找哈希碰撞来推断出明文。

  • 游戏规则:

    • 游戏方生成两个不同的明文,使得它们的哈希值相同。
    • 玩家需要通过询问特定的明文字来推断出这两个明文。
  • 玩法策略:

    • 利用已知的哈希值,寻找可能的碰撞点。
    • 通过数学方法缩小可能的明文范围。

哈希链式推理

玩家需要通过已知的哈希值和部分明文字,构建一个哈希链,最终推断出完整的明文。

  • 游戏规则:

    • 游戏方生成一个链式结构,每个节点的哈希值依赖于前一个节点。
    • 玩家需要通过询问特定的明文字,逐步推断出整个链式结构。
  • 玩法策略:

    • 从已知的节点开始,逐步推断出后续的节点。
    • 利用哈希函数的确定性,确保每一步的推断都是正确的。

哈希解密挑战

玩家需要根据已知的哈希值和部分明文字,解密出完整的密文。

  • 游戏规则:

    • 游戏方生成一个密文,并对它进行哈希处理。
    • 玩家需要通过询问特定的明文字,逐步推断出完整的密文。
  • 玩法策略:

    • 利用已知的哈希值,逆向推断出可能的密文。
    • 通过数学方法缩小可能的范围。

哈希竞猜游戏的注意事项

  1. 时间限制:在实际游戏中,时间限制是重要的资源,玩家需要在有限的时间内尽可能多地推断出正确的明文。

  2. 资源消耗:哈希计算和碰撞寻找需要大量的计算资源,玩家需要合理分配资源,避免超时。

  3. 安全性和道德问题:哈希函数本身是安全的,但玩家在游戏过程中可能涉及真实的密码或敏感信息,游戏方需要确保游戏的公正性和安全性。

  4. 策略优化:玩家需要根据游戏的具体规则和哈希函数的特性,优化自己的猜测策略,提高推断效率。

哈希竞猜游戏作为一种智力游戏,不仅考验参与者的逻辑推理能力,还要求他们具备一定的密码学知识,通过本文的详细解析,我们了解了几种常见的哈希竞猜游戏玩法,包括密码破解挑战、哈希碰撞寻找、哈希链式推理和哈希解密挑战,这些玩法不仅有趣,还具有一定的挑战性和教育意义,随着哈希技术的不断发展,我们可以期待更多创新的哈希竞猜游戏玩法的出现。

哈希竞猜游戏玩法有哪些?全面解析

哈希竞猜游戏玩法有哪些?全面解析哈希竞猜游戏玩法有哪些,

发表评论